Drove down to one of the bikeshops around here to check out the Suzuki DRZ400SMK. The first time I saw the bike 2 weeks ago... it was US$6250 MSRP (Manufacturer's sale recommended price) ie machine price in our Singapore lingo. He told me Suzuki was having a year end sale so the bike is now priced at US$5295!!!!!!

 

So I asked how much would cost me to get the machine on the road and the answer was with the sales tax, registration and all the other admin thingy... US$6250. I had to get my own insurance though which I did by calling up my auto insurance company and giving them the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) aka frame number... and amazingly the lady operator could tell me that the bike is a 2007 Suzuki DRZ 400 SMK!!! Am amazed at how this information is linked to them.

 

The next shocker was the salesman asked me if I had brought my riding gear along coz the bike will go into their workshop for some preparation ie put on the number plate holder and top off the necessary fluids, put in a new battery and I can ride it home!!! The licence plate will be sent to me by mail.. all they were going to stick on the number plate holder was a piece of paper stating that it is temporary registration plate valid for one month.

 

Anyway.. I declined to take the bike today.. will do so on Monday morning. Need to get the lever guards fitted first. Was thinking of putting on an aftermarket exhaust. Monday I will go see what kinds they have. The salesman told me that some of the aftermarket exhausts they have are very loud... but he never say must go for decibel checks.. wahahahahah!! Just need to rejet the carbs for more power!

 

Makes realise that to buy a bike in Singapore is really quite a hassle when compared to here in the USA.
